Oh and T@ll, I saw the thread you were talkin about. From what I saw you were asking if you could daisy chain a few power strips to use with a HPS.
Don't daisy chain them. You could add as any as you wanted and it wont raise the amount of load it can handle. If your looking for a way to elongate the power cable, just get an extension cable? Different strips are rated differently. If your going to use a single strip as your global power point, then get one rated 15A @ 120V (or 115, same thing).
